CRE163 Ruby und Rails
Die dynamische und agile Entwicklungsumgebung für Web- und andere
Anwendungen
2 Stunden 24 Minuten
Podcast
Podcaster
Beschreibung
vor 14 Jahren
Ruby hat sich in den letzten Jahren den Ruf einer der beliebtesten
Programmiersprachen verdient und hat nachweislich die Anwendungen
innovativer Webanwendungen spürbar nach vorne gebracht. Vor allem
das Framework Ruby on Rails hat der Sprache viele neue Freunde
eingebracht. Im Gespräch mit Tim Pritlove berichtet Martin Wöginger
von seiner Liebe zu und seinen Erfahrungen mit Ruby und Ruby on
Rails und stellt Eigenschaften, Vor- und Nachteile der
Entwicklungsumgebung vor. Themen: Geschichte und verwandte
Programmiersprache; Designprinzipien von Ruby; Syntax Sugar;
Sprachkonzepte, Objektorientierung und Modularisierung; Erweitern
von Basisklassen; Kontrollstrukturen und Closures; Eingebaute
Datentypen; Vor- und Nachteile von Ruby; Implementierungen; Ruby on
Rails; ORM und ActiveRecord; das Model-View-Controller-Modell;
Hosting von Ruby-Anwendungen; Paketmanagement; Setup on
Rails-Anwendungen; Programmieren mit Tests und Behaviour-driven
Development; Anlegen und Migrieren von Datenbanken; Scaffolding;
Restful Programming; Sicherheitsaspekte; Resourcen; Ruby und der
Mac.
Programmiersprachen verdient und hat nachweislich die Anwendungen
innovativer Webanwendungen spürbar nach vorne gebracht. Vor allem
das Framework Ruby on Rails hat der Sprache viele neue Freunde
eingebracht. Im Gespräch mit Tim Pritlove berichtet Martin Wöginger
von seiner Liebe zu und seinen Erfahrungen mit Ruby und Ruby on
Rails und stellt Eigenschaften, Vor- und Nachteile der
Entwicklungsumgebung vor. Themen: Geschichte und verwandte
Programmiersprache; Designprinzipien von Ruby; Syntax Sugar;
Sprachkonzepte, Objektorientierung und Modularisierung; Erweitern
von Basisklassen; Kontrollstrukturen und Closures; Eingebaute
Datentypen; Vor- und Nachteile von Ruby; Implementierungen; Ruby on
Rails; ORM und ActiveRecord; das Model-View-Controller-Modell;
Hosting von Ruby-Anwendungen; Paketmanagement; Setup on
Rails-Anwendungen; Programmieren mit Tests und Behaviour-driven
Development; Anlegen und Migrieren von Datenbanken; Scaffolding;
Restful Programming; Sicherheitsaspekte; Resourcen; Ruby und der
Mac.
Weitere Episoden
2 Stunden 47 Minuten
vor 2 Jahren
1 Stunde 55 Minuten
vor 2 Jahren
2 Stunden 7 Minuten
vor 3 Jahren
5 Minuten
vor 3 Jahren
3 Stunden 37 Minuten
vor 3 Jahren
In Podcasts werben
Kommentare (0)